Summary
The Multi-Dimensional Ethical AI Adoption Model (MEAAM) categorizes 13 variables across four dimensions for ethical AI in healthcare. Analyzed through epistemic, normative, and overarching ethics, the study uses PLS-SEM to assess the impact of constructs like transparency, trust, justice, fairness, and privacy on AI adoption. Key findings highlight the importance of these elements for both operational and systemic AI stages. The research advances theoretical understanding and provides practical insights for healthcare leaders, policymakers, and developers. Future research could include longitudinal studies, sector-specific investigations, and qualitative methods.
